Canon has launched the PowerShot SX740, a compact camera that offers 40x optical zoom.
The pocket sized camera features 4K Ultra HD video capabilities, Wi-Fi and Bluetooth smartphone connectivity and a range of automatic settings.
The PowerShot SX740 features ZoomPlus technology, which digitally increases the 40x optical zoom to 80x. The combination of the DIGIC 8 processor and CMOS sensor make it easy to create sharp, colourful and high definition photos and videos, according to Canon.
The camera also includes 5-axis stabilisation and rapid autofocus.
The PowerShot SX740 integrates with smart devices using the free Canon Camera Connect app for compatible iOS and Android devices. Photos and video can be transferred from the camera to smart devices automatically. Content can also be saved to Canon’s Irista cloud storage platform or synced wirelessly to PCs and Macs.
The Canon Power Shot SX740 will be available from the beginning of September.
